Driving expert Sergei Kanunnikov collected 10 iconic films of the USSR, in which a large part of the screen time is devoted to cars – in fact, we remember these films largely because of the cars.
And, of course, here one cannot ignore the cult for boys of different generations film “Racers” directed by Igor Maslennikov, released in 1972. The film is well made and still looks good.

The picture appeared in the heyday of the Soviet rally, when our cars and racers also performed well abroad. The main car of the film is the Moskvich-412, which had successfully completed the London-Sydney and London-Mexico City Marathons by the time of the film’s release.
